Description
The Jackson JS3 Concert Bass features an Indian cedro body, a fully bound bolt-on maple neck with Indian rosewood fingerboard, 24 jumbo frets, 35" scale, Jackson dual humbucking high output pickups, a high-mass bridge, and black hardware. Experts consider the shark to be evolutionary perfection - the ultimate killing machine. Swift, sleek and deadly. The Jackson JS Series is the affordable axe equivalent. Built with 30 years worth of Jackson expertise, each JS is swift, sleek and deadly.
Compound Radius Neck
The neck is the most important part of any bass. The Jackson JS2 has a compound radius neck that begins with a smaller radius at the nut that gradually becomes larger as you play up towards the bridge. Guitarists and bassists alike appreciate a compound radius neck for the comfort and speed in fingering it allows. Case sold separately.

Features
- Concert bass body style
- Indian cedro body
- Bolt-on maple neck
- Indian rosewood fingerboard
- Compound neck radius
- Ivory headstock and neck binding
- MOTO shark fin position inlays
- Jackson active humbucking pickups
- Neck Volume, Bridge Volume, Bass, Mid, and Treble controls
- Jackson high-mass bridge
- Jackson non-locking tuners
- Case sold separately
Specs
- 12" to 16" compound neck radius
- 35" scale length
- 24 Jumbo frets
- 1.6525" nut width
